Overview

Postcode PO22 6LA is located in an urban city, within the Middleton-on-Sea ward of Arun in the South East region, and forms part of the Middleton-on-Sea area. It has moderate deprivation and very low crime levels, with around 27.7 crimes per 1,000 residents per year. The average income per household in Middleton-on-Sea is £50,429 per year. The nearest station is Littlehampton located about 2.7 miles away.

Property prices in Middleton-on-Sea

Based on 93 recent sales, the median property price is £361,000 in Middleton-on-Sea area, with individual transactions ranging from £80,000 up to £1,100,000.
